AI的未来:深度学习的潜力

本文探讨了深度学习在人工智能中的重要性,介绍了深度学习的基本概念、核心算法和最佳实践,强调了其在计算机视觉、自然语言处理等多个领域的应用,并展望了未来的发展趋势和挑战。同时,提供了相关工具和资源的推荐。
摘要由CSDN通过智能技术生成

AI的未来:深度学习的潜力

作者:禅与计算机程序设计艺术

1. 背景介绍

人工智能作为当今科技发展的前沿和主要驱动力之一,正在以前所未有的速度推动各个领域的变革。其中,深度学习作为人工智能的核心技术之一,在近年来取得了突破性的进展,在计算机视觉、自然语言处理、语音识别等诸多领域取得了令人瞩目的成就。深度学习的快速发展,不仅极大地提升了人工智能的整体水平,也为人工智能未来的发展指明了方向。

2. 核心概念与联系

深度学习是机器学习的一个分支,它通过构建由多个隐藏层组成的人工神经网络,学习数据的内在特征和规律,从而实现对复杂问题的高效建模和求解。与传统的机器学习方法相比,深度学习具有自动特征提取、端到端学习、高度泛化能力等优势,在处理大规模、高维复杂数据方面表现出色。

深度学习的核心概念包括:

  1. 人工神经网络:由输入层、隐藏层和输出层组成的多层神经元结构,通过反向传播算法进行端到端的参数优化学习。
  2. 卷积神经网络:一种专门用于处理二维图像数据的深度神经网络,通过局部连接和参数共享等机制实现高效特征提取。
  3. 循环神经网络:一种擅长处理序列数据的深度神经网络,通过引入记忆单元和反馈连接实现对时间序列的建模。
  4. 注意力机制:一种用于增强神经网络对关键信息的关注度的技术,在自然语言处理和计算机视觉等领域取得广泛应用。

这些核心概念相互关联,共同构成了深度学习的基础理论和技术框架,推动着人工智能技术的不断创新和进步。

3. 核心算法原理和具体操作步骤

深度学习的核心算法原理主要包括:

  1. $\text{损失函数}$:通过定义合适的损失函数,描述模型输出与真实标签之间的差距,为模型优化提供依据。常用的损失函数包括均方误差、交叉熵等。
  2. $\text{反向传播}$:利用链式法则,将损失函数对模型参数的梯度反向传播至各层,实现参数的迭代优化更新。
  3. $\text{优化算法}$:常用的优化算法包括随机梯度下降、Adam、RMSProp等,通过调整学习率等超参数控制优化过程。
  4. $\text{正则化}$:通过添加L1/L2正则项、dropout、数据增强等技术,防止模型过拟合,提高泛化能力。
  5. $\text{批量归一化}$:在隐藏层之间插入批量归一化层,减小内部协变量偏移,加速模型收敛。

具体的深度学习模型训练步骤如下:

  1. 数据预处理:包括数据清洗、特征工程、数据增强等步骤,提高
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值